**ALERT: FormulaCage sandbox breach attempt detected**

Triggered when a user-supplied formula in Gridlume attempts a blocked syscall or exceeds the memory ceiling. Usually benign (runaway recursion), occasionally a probe. Review the captured formula AST before approving any allowlist change. Repeated triggers from one tenant warrant escalation. Forward suspicious payloads to the sandbox security desk.

escalation mailbox, bafog-fafog: ulador@paliqlabs.internal

# FeeForge Contacts

FeeForge is the rules engine computing shipping fees for all Brindlecart storefronts. Owned by the Pricing Platform team at Ostermill. Rule definitions live in the locked `fee-rules` repo; runtime secrets are rotated quarterly. Security findings: do not file public tickets. Severity-1 issues (rule tampering, fee bypass) go straight to the on-call lead, Mara Delquist, who coordinates disclosure. For audit scope questions, ask the platform architect, Joren Habbe. Report all security concerns to the team's triage inbox.

alerts address for bajop-yahog: istwyn@lumiclabs.internal

Q2 Planning Note — Sales Leads

The licensing dispute with Ferranti-Oaks over the Skylark toolkit remains unresolved. Legal expects mediation within six weeks. Until then: no new Skylark bundles, no renewal discounts referencing the toolkit, and all related prospect questions go to Dana Welch. Existing contracts are unaffected. Pipeline impact estimated at single digits this quarter. Plan quotas accordingly. The following applies before any customer-facing commitments are made.

management briefing: The pricing group signed off on a budget of $378.8 million for Project Kasael.